Concept catalog (DOC-164 slice 6+)
Build or refresh the cross-sidecar concept catalog at lineage/{repo}/concepts.yaml. The catalog clusters every per-node sidecar's concepts block by semantic equivalence, anchors names against the canonical vocabulary in documentation/docs/main-concepts.md, and surfaces canonicalisation candidates for the maintainer to decide on.
This skill is the second reducer in the agentic-code-ontology layer (per adrs/drafts/agentic-code-ontology.md rev 2). The first per-node enrichment slice was /enrich (slice 5). /concepts consumes the sidecars /enrich produced.

Incremental input resolution
Before spawning the subagent in default (incremental) mode, the skill computes:
PROCESSED_NODE_IDS — read from prior concepts.yaml's frontmatter processed_node_ids: field. If the field is missing (pre-v0.2 catalog), fall back to --full for this run.
NEW_SIDECAR_FILES — Glob lineage/{repo}/understanding/*.md minus the set whose YAML frontmatter node_id: is in PROCESSED_NODE_IDS. Empty set → report "Nothing to refresh (no new sidecars)" and exit without invoking the subagent.
PRIOR_HEAD — one line per concept from prior concepts.yaml, derived via grep -E '^ - name:' + per-entry contributing_files length count. Use the compact-head shape from playbooks/reducer-incremental-mode.md.
CURATED_ENTRIES — verbatim YAML of every concept entry with maintainer_curated: true, extracted by parsing the prior catalog.
These four values + MODE: incremental get passed to the subagent in place of the legacy EXISTING_CATALOG block.

4. Validate the resulting catalog
After the subagent reports completion:
- Confirm
lineage/{repo}/concepts.yaml exists.
- Parse it as YAML (Bash
python -c "import yaml; yaml.safe_load(open('...'))" or skip if no Python available).
- Verify the four top-level lists exist:
entities, operations, invariants, audiences. Empty lists are fine; missing keys are an error.
- Verify each concept entry has
name, nodes, contributors, evidence. Missing fields = log warning + report.
- Verify every
nodes entry references a real node ID — sample-check 5 random entries via jq against lineage/{repo}/nodes.jsonl. If a sample finds a fabricated node ID, that's a CRITICAL FAIL — the catalog is unreliable; report + ask the maintainer how to proceed.

Rules
- Live-URL-only doc rule applies here too. The subagent's prompt requires that when it cites
documentation/docs/main-concepts.md, the citation is from a file Read in this session — not pretraining recall. The skill provides the path/content; the subagent does not invent canonical-vocabulary entries from memory.
- Maintainer-curated preservation. If a concept entry in the existing
concepts.yaml is flagged maintainer_curated: true, the subagent preserves its name, description, and notes verbatim. The nodes, contributors, and evidence fields may update if new sidecars contribute (they're auto-derived); the maintainer's prose stays.
- Don't dedup canonicalisation candidates. Even if a candidate appears similar to an existing entry, surface both. The maintainer is the only judge of canonical-vocabulary changes.
- Reducer doesn't fix sidecar quality. If a sidecar's
concepts block is sparse or unclear, concept-merger notes the contribution but does not "fill in" missing concepts. Sparse sidecars surface as a quality finding for /enrich --node <id> to refresh, not for the reducer to paper over.
- Skip auto-write on validation failure. If the subagent's output fails schema validation, the file gets written to
lineage/{repo}/.concepts-staged.yaml instead and the maintainer reviews before promoting to concepts.yaml. (Slice-6 MVP: simpler — write directly and report failure.)
Failure modes to surface (not auto-fix)
- Subagent claims a concept appears in node X but X isn't in
nodes.jsonl → catalog is rejected; maintainer iterates the prompt
- Canonical-vocabulary fetch failed (local file missing, WebFetch returned non-200) → catalog uses
canonical_in_docs: unknown for entries that can't be classified; maintainer re-runs after fixing
- More than 30% of entries land in
canonicalisation_candidates → either the canonical vocab is genuinely undersized (real signal worth maintainer review) OR the sidecars are noisy (refresh /enrich may help). Surface to maintainer rather than silently emit a low-quality catalog.
